SEX ABUSE VICTIM MADE ATTEMPT ON HER OWN LIFE AFTER BEING CROSS-EXAMINED IN COURT

A young girl who was just five years old when she was sexually abused by Matthew Toyer has had her attacker sentenced at Newport Crown Court.

Her mother told the court that her daughter had become fearful, confused, and was unable to sleep as a result of the abuse.

Following the trial, her daughter attempted to take her own life.

Toyer, aged 46 and residing in Abergavenny, was found guilty on multiple charges including penetrating her and inducing her to touch his genitals.

He had instructed her to keep the abuse secret, but the truth emerged after she made a disturbing comment to her mother.

The court was informed that Toyer faced two counts of assaulting a girl under 13 by penetration and one of inciting sexual activity involving a child.

The trial revealed he had no prior criminal record.

During a victim impact statement read by prosecutor Ian Wright, her mother explained how their lives were irrevocably changed when her daughter made what appeared to be a simple remark, which led to the horrifying discovery of the abuse.

She described the trauma of police interviews and social worker visits, and how deciding on a medical examination was an emotional challenge.

Her mother described her daughter's drastic change: she became scared, confused, and unable to sleep, seeking physical comfort from her family.

Once a confident and lively girl, her security was shattered overnight.

The mother emphasized how the abuse tarnished her daughter’s innocence and distorted her understanding of love and responsibility.

She detailed how the court process left her daughter in distress, with her questioning reality after cross-examination.

Later, she found her daughter attempting to end her life, requiring intervention.

The mother expressed concern about the enduring impact of the abuse on her daughter’s self-esteem, understanding of safety, and future relationships.

She criticized the justice system’s harshness.

In mitigation, Owen Williams highlighted Toyer’s background as a successful businessman and a reservist firefighter.

Judge Eugene Egan highlighted her young age as a significant vulnerability.

Toyer was sentenced to 15 years in prison with a one-year extended license period, deemed a dangerous offender.

A 20-year restraining order was also issued, along with sex offender notification requirements.
